    Spader was diagnosed with early CRF on New Year's Eve '04. He was also a diet controlled diabetic, until a dental at the end of December of '06 put him
    back on the juice. I went out with Janet's food charts in hand and bought various low carb, low phos, medium protein foods and did a hit or miss approach until I came up with the magic mix he ate. The other cans stayed in the pantry just in case he got picky. I bought various flavors of Wellness, Merrick, Nature's Variety, Hi-Tor Neo, PetGuard, Pinnacle, Iams, Newman’s Own, etc.

    I had been doing fluids on my own with a lot of success. The vets matched the internet prices, so that helped out a lot.
    Also, I put several cups of purified water around the house and purchased a cat fountain (The Cat-It). I also added water to his canned food.

    He ate mostly the low phos Friskies Special Diet flavors and FF Chicken and Tuna. Sometimes he got picky and ate all meat baby food.

    I ended up adding a phosphorus binder during the last year and a half.
